Humans have been inspired by the designs of nature since the beginning of our existence so it only makes sense that to develop an extremely sensitive temperature sensor, engineers took a close look at temperature-sensitive plants. Then they developed a hybrid material that contains, in addition to synthetic components, the plant cells themselves. The result is an electronic module that changes its conductivity as a function of temperature. "No other sensor can respond to such small temperature fluctuations with such large changes in conductivity.
